HUNTING THE KILLER: TED BUNDY
Thursday, August 10 at 21:15 on Sky Cinema Uno and live NOW, also available on request.
Director and screenwriter Daniel Farrands, a specialist in the genre of horror and biographical thrillers, brings to the screen the stories of two serial killers who left a terrible bloody trail in the United States: Eileen Wuornos (already brought to the big screen by Charlize Theron in Monster) and Ted Bundy. In this film, we see how, in the 70s, FBI agents Kathleen McChesney and Robert Ressler hunted down one of the most dangerous serial killers the United States has ever seen: Ted Bundy.

NINGALOO – THE UNDERWATER WONDERS OF AUSTRALIA
From Friday 11 August at 21:15 on Sky Nature and live NOW, also available on request.
The Ningaloo Coast is a biodiversity paradise located in the coastal area of ​​Western Australia and has been declared a World Heritage Site since 2011. Along the coast is the Ningaloo Barrier Reef, which, with its length of 260 km, is the only major barrier reef. located close to the mainland. In fact, the coast owes its name to the Aboriginal word Wajarri ningaloo, which means “headland” or “high cliff approaching the sea.” In this exciting series, we explore how cataclysms shaped Ningaloo Reef, Cape Range and Exmouth Bay and map the ecological, migratory and relational features that preserve biodiversity.
